There is no direct connection from Saint Davids to Ireland. However, you can take the bus to Fishguard & Goodwick Station, walk to Fishguard & Goodwick, take the train to Fishguard Harbour, walk to Fishguard Harbour, take the ferry to Rosslare Harbour, walk to Rosslare Europort, then take the train to Dublin Pearse.
